Meaning

粗略 describes something done in a rough, approximate, or superficial manner without paying attention to details. It refers to estimates, descriptions, or examinations that are not precise or thorough. The word combines 粗 (coarse/rough) and 略 (brief/omit), together meaning to skip over details.

Usage

Commonly used to describe rough estimates, brief overviews, or preliminary examinations. Often appears in phrases like 粗略地看 (to glance over roughly) or 粗略估计 (rough estimate). It carries a neutral tone, simply indicating lack of detail rather than being necessarily negative.

Antonyms

Origin

The character 粗 originally referred to unrefined rice or coarse texture, while 略 means to abbreviate or略over. Together they form a word meaning to handle something in a rough or abbreviated way.
